Sunday Morning Services

Sunday Morning Schedule
10:00am Children’s RE Children’s religious education programs (downstairs).
10:50am “Morning Songs” Join us for ten minutes of singing prior to the “regular” service. The words will be projected overhead and the songs will be singable by adults and kids — some old favorites, some new, led by our music director and members of the choir.
11:00am Sunday Service (See below for speakers & topics).
12:00pm “Coffee Time” We invite you to remain after the service for coffee and conversation.
12:15pm “Reverberations” If you’d like to share, have questions, need further explanation, etc.

Unitarian Universalist services are similar to most other churches. There are readings and hymns, often live instrumental or choral music. There is a time for people to share significant events in their lives. There is often a story for children early in the service, before they leave the sanctuary for childcare downstairs. You are welcome to visit and to explore with us. Wear whatever makes you comfortable!

January 25

Nayer Taheri

Let Us Stand On the Side of Love

Does war have any place in a just society? Can there be such a thing as good war? What bearing has war upon our quest for meaning? These are the questions that the UUA Draft on Peacemaking tries to answer. Nayer will explore answers to these fundamental questions and look into our UU heritage for encouragement and support on the path to peace and justice.
